ManyCam 2.6.1 is a legacy version of the popular virtual webcam software, originally released around October 2010. While it remains a lightweight choice for users on older operating systems, it frequently encounters compatibility issues with modern apps like Zoom, Skype, and Windows 10/11.

Since version 2.6.1 is old, it lacks modern built-in codecs. Installing the K-Lite Codec Pack can provide the necessary system-level support for ManyCam to decode various video formats. 4. Correcting "ManyCam.exe" Errors
